#b4597a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b4597a is composed of 70.6% red, 34.9% green and 47.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.6% magenta, 32.2%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 338.2 degrees, a saturation of 37.8% and a lightness of 52.7%. #b4597a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2f4 with #690000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#b4597a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0406 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b4597a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f7e84 is the less saturated color, while #fe0f66 is the most saturated one.
